Volunteers of America is a charitable organization founded in 1896 that provides support services to vulnerable populations across America. The organization operates nursing homes, healthcare facilities, and social service programs for veterans, at-risk youth, elderly individuals, formerly incarcerated people, homeless populations, and those with disabilities or addiction issues. With multiple locations nationwide, Volunteers of America integrates compassionate care with effective programs that address physical, mental, and spiritual needs through a comprehensive approach to community support and rehabilitation services.
